Definitions

from The Century Dictionary.

  • noun A member of the genus Chauliodes, of the neuropterous family Sialidæ; specifically, the combhorned fish-fly, Chauliodes pectinicornis.

from the GNU version of the Collaborative International Dictionary of English.

  • noun (Zoöl.) a fly similar to but smaller than the dobsonfly.

from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License.

  • noun Canada A mayfly.

from WordNet 3.0 Copyright 2006 by Princeton University. All rights reserved.

  • noun similar to but smaller than the dobsonfly; larvae are used as fishing bait
